The Fuller Woman Network (TFW) will again travel to Detroit, Michigan to host the Second Annual International Fuller Woman Expo on September 18, 2010 in the beautiful Westin Book Cadillac Hotel. This will be graced by the popular actress, comedian and motivational speaker Kim Coles as its keynote speaker.
Presented to you by The Fuller Woman Network, The Fuller Woman Expo is the largest international consumer trade show dedicated to Curvier Women. It is an empowering event embracing women for who they are and uplifting them with a positive approach. The Fuller Woman Network is dedicated to empowering women to recognize her internal and external beauty; to educate and motivate through workshops and seminars while providing information on the products and/or services available to them through companies across the world that share the same mission for positive imagery and social relevance in today’s society.
The Fuller Woman Network aims to change the way people regard size. TFW Expo Founder, Georgia Greenwood says, “We are all different, some are tall some short some Black, White, Asian, slim or fat and that’s the way it will always be. Once people truly begin to realize this, racism and size-ism will be eliminated and The Fuller Woman Expo is a step in that direction.”
Following the success of the inaugural expo in Detroit last year, that attracted more than 1000 patrons and business owners, it is expected that the 2010 expo will even reach greater heights. The Fuller Woman Expo is a great venue for organizations or companies to promote their best products and services that includes fashion, beauty, health, home, career, financial planning, education and a lot more. This open doors of opportunities for exhibitors and consumers to connect, and strengthens company’s image within the plus size community.
